Sorts Of Water Therapy Polymers
Often used in wastewater therapy, water treatment polymers are necessary for boosting the efficiency of coagulation and flocculation processes. These polymers can be extensively categorized right into 3 main types: anionic, cationic, and non-ionic.
Anionic polymers, which lug an adverse fee, are especially effective in treating wastewater with favorably charged pollutants. They assist in the gathering of suspended fragments, promoting the development of bigger flocs that clear up quicker. Conversely, cationic polymers have a favorable cost and are often used in applications where negatively billed bits dominate, such as in specific industrial effluents. Their capability to neutralize fees makes it possible for the reliable binding of bits, resulting in boosted sedimentation prices.
Non-ionic polymers, doing not have a fee, work as versatile representatives that can improve the efficiency of both anionic and cationic polymers. Their key role entails enhancing the thickness of the wastewater, thereby enhancing the general retention time of the flocs in the treatment system.
Recognizing the distinct characteristics of these sorts of water therapy polymers enables the optimization of wastewater therapy processes, inevitably resulting in boosted removal effectiveness and enhanced water top quality.
